6,162 Steps to Miles, By Height

The 2,000-steps-per-mile figure above is a flat average. Stride length actually scales with height, so the same 6,162 steps covers a different distance depending on how tall the walker is.

HeightDistance
Short (~5'2")2.50 mi
Average (~5'7")2.70 mi
Tall (~6'2")2.98 mi

Where 6,162 Steps Ranks

Activity levels are commonly grouped by daily step count. Here's where 6,162 steps falls.

Activity LevelDaily Steps
SedentaryUnder 5,000
Low Active5,000–7,499
Somewhat Active7,500–9,999
Active10,000–12,499
Highly Active12,500+

Walking upright costs humans roughly a quarter of the energy that walking on all fours would, according to a study comparing human and chimpanzee locomotion. That efficiency is a big part of why our ancestors could travel further between food sources as forests thinned into open grassland.

Nietzsche was blunt about it: "all truly great thoughts are conceived while walking." He, Kierkegaard, and Rousseau all wrote about walking as close to essential for their thinking, not just exercise.

How long does it take to walk 6,162 steps?

At an average walking pace of about 3 mph, 6,162 steps takes roughly 1 hr 2 min. Walking slower or faster will shift that time up or down.
